Cristiano Ronaldo left Getafe with a brace and another win for Carlo Ancelotti’s men. He has also now scored 15 league goals against Los Azulones, now the Portuguese striker’s second favourite victim (only behind Sevilla, with 16 goals). Another bonus also came in the form of goalscoring records, putting him up alongside or above Messi and Raúl.
Cristiano has scored 28 goals in the first half of the season, equalling Leo Messi’s record from the 2012/2013 season. It is also worth remembering that Madrid still have one game left to play, their game against Sevilla in the Bernabéu that was rescheduled because of the Club World Cup, which means he could still overtake the Argentine. However, the Madrid star did break one record in the Coliseum Alfonso Pérez. Before the game he had scored 87 away goals in La Liga, the same as Raúl in a white shirt. After his brace, Cristiano is now out on his own as Los Blancos’ top scorer away from the Bernabéu.
